Local assessors in Racine, WI have categorized 715 Lathrop Avenue as a residential type of property.
The home was built in 1930 and is 94 years old.
The property's lot size has been calculated to be 5,489 square feet.
The linear feet between the front and back of the lot was measured at 1,391 ft and the front of the lot was measured at 400 ft.
Now, let's dive a bit deeper into the details surrounding the home on the property. There are 7 rooms in the home. Of these, 3 have been legally categorized as bedrooms. For more details, please view your local government regulations on what counts as a legal bedroom.
As for the restroom situation, there is one full bathroom.
There is also a partial bathroom.
This is a 2 story home so residents will need to have climb at least one set of stairs on a daily basis.
If we look only at the heated or air conditioned part of the building, then 715 Lathrop Avenue has a total of 1,542 sqft of living area.
Note that this number does not include the square footage of the garage, basement, and/or porch into its calculations.

According to our sources, 715 Lathrop Avenue sold most recently in Feb 14, 2020 for a total of $135,000. If you work out the math, that's approximately a cost of $87.55 per sqft. Before that, the property was also sold for $150,000 in Mar 29, 2005. There could be many factors that caused the property to sell at a lower price and decrease in value. Tax-wise, the current owner is expected to pay close to $4,696 in taxes each year. 715 Lathrop Avenue was most recently assessed in 2023. During this assessment, the property's total value was estimated to be about $185,000. If we break it down further, the land itself was valued at $18,000. Improvements to the property, however, were assessed at a total of $167,000. Homeowners who care about taxes, will be happy to see that the property's total assessed value has been marked as less than the total market value.
